Geotechnical engineers check out the types and geological frameworks of dirts at construction websites and ensure that huge structures such as high buildings, dams, roadways, or brand-new municipalities are developed to fit the soil conditions or stamina of the rock - Specialized Geotechnical Engineering Solutions. They make sure the firm and secure building and construction of the foundations in one of the most cost-efficient way


They carry index out theoretical and employed researches of groundwater flow and contamination, and they develop specs for site choice, treatment and construction. They additionally plan, create, coordinate and carry out academic and experimental research studies in mining expedition, examination and feasibility studies when it come to the mining industry. They conduct surveys and studies of ore deposits, ore book computations and mine layout.


Most of what geotechnical engineers do is concealed listed below the ground surface, yet it is a very important technique with a vast extent, as all buildings need to hinge on or in the ground. Geotechnical engineers make use of basic concepts of soil mechanics to explore subsurface problems. This allows them to assess and design tasks such as the stability of natural inclines and synthetic dirt down payments, shallow and deep structures, dams, retaining walls, tunnels and lots of other jobs directly engaging with subsoil and water. Any kind of geotechnical engineering job is various; indeed the dirt conditions on a website are most likely various from any type of various other website


The most typical technique for soft dirt conditions in the Netherlands is a Cone Infiltration Test (CPT), which is made use of to determine the geotechnical design residential properties. This test method is accomplished in situ and includes pushing an instrumented downfacing cone with sensors right into the ground at a controlled price.


This data is made use of by geotechnical designers to establish the soil type and the soil residential properties. For intricate tasks additional boreholes are made to gather samples in the field which can be analysed in the lab. For harder subsoils, boreholes with Standard Penetration Examinations (SPT) are a method of exploring the dirt.


The number of strikes to get to an infiltration of 1 foot (30 cm) in the dirt is gauged. The SPT blow matter gives an indicator of the soil resistance and can be used to obtain the toughness and stiffness specifications of the dirt.
